Arbel Ancient Synagogue /
Beautiful ruins of an ancient synagogue from the 4th century BCE.
— בית הכנסת העתיק —
It is a square building belonging to the Galilean type of synagogue with a number of special components:
• The main entrance in the eastern wall.
• The niche for holy ark in the wall facing Jerusalem.
• The arrangement of the benches.
Erected by Israel Nature and Parks Authority.

Regarding Arbel Ancient Synagogue /. Arbel
The door of the synagogue, still standing, was carved from a massive natural outcropping of limestone, and the synagogue itself situated so as to make use of the stone as a handsome door. It is carved with decorative floral motifs and medallions. A carved groove for a mezuzah can be seen. Three sides of the building had carved stone benches. The two story building had three rows of columns with Corinthian capitals on the first floor and Ionic capitals on the second floor. It was also a site fortified by Zahir al-Umar.
